3 Safe Beverages for Acid Reflux or GERD

It's quite a challenge for people who are suffering from digestive disorders such as acid reflux or GERD to look for foods which "work best" for them. For most individuals with this type of condition, one mistake in a meal is all it takes to cause further pain (not to mention frustration as well).

Simply knowing the difference between acid and alkaline foods is a good start. And along with it, knowing what kind of beverages are best to take while undergoing treatment. Here are 3 safe ones you can count on:

1. Water -- In a league of its own, the greatest beverage on Earth is still water. If it's alkaline, then it's better. Let me rephrase that: alkaline water is the best during treatment stage. But by and large, water cleanses your body by carrying away harmful wastes, and at the same time providing much needed moisture. If you are looking for one good natural cure for GERD, acid reflux, or any digestive problem that you have, make it a habit to drink at least 5-8 cups of alkaline water.

As a precaution though, be wary that you should not drink too much with any meal. Too much would be no more than 8 oz. of any beverage. Doing so, will dilute your stomach and hinder proper digestion.

2. Vegetable Juice -- And not just any kind of vegetable juice. I'm talking fresh vegetable juice. The canned and bottled ones are acidic and should be avoided as much as possible. The fresh ones give you the freedom to drink it freely (take note of the precaution I mentioned in my last paragraph). If you're a vegetarian, this should not be any problem with you, as you can make the necessary switch in no time. If not, well.. it's best to start learning and doing it now, because it would really give your esophagus and stomach that much needed "alkaline break".

3. Herbal Tea -- This is another safe drink you can count on, along with your meals. Green tea is one of my favorite choices. You want to avoid black tea as it is acidic.


There are other good beverages that are safe for people with GERD or acid reflux, though they are not many. If you're starting or mid-way in the treatment process, it's best to stick with these three, while trying out other drinks one at a time
